
BIO
Trevis was formerly directly responsible for MKAA operations and maintenance organization division consisting of nearly 100 staff members, and also served in senior leadership roles for the organization as Chief Information Officer and Chief Personnel Officer. Trevis also served in a combination of the US Air Force and the Tennessee Air National Guard from 1987 to 2011 where he rose from the rank of enlisted airman to commissioned officer and served in various roles including First Sergeant and Deputy Group Commander. Trevis has very effectively served multiple terms in local elected offices as a member and also chairman of the Blount County Board of Education. He has been very engaged in the community and region as a volunteer in public education, leadership development initiatives, and projects including serving as the Chairman of the Blount County Chamber of Commerce and chair of the chamber foundation.
Brief Experience History
Trevis had the privilege of serving with the US Air Force and then continuing in the Tennessee Air National Guard (TNANG) for a total sum of 24 years. He was assigned as Engineering and Land Survey Technician/Electrical Power Production and Distribution Journeyman and Master Technician and received promotions into the Non-Commissioned Officer (NCO) ranks. After being promoted to a Senior Non-Commissioned Officer, he filled the roles as Instructor-NCO Academy, NCO in Charge-Site Development and Engineering, and as First Sergeant. Trevis was commissioned as an Air Force Commissioned Officer and performed in various roles including the Logistics Readiness Officer, the Airbase Operability Officer, and finally served as the Deputy Commander/ Executive Officer, retiring from the TNANG after serving in this last assignment.
Trevis served as the Vice President Operations, Chief Personnel Officer, and Chief Information Officer for both the McGhee Tyson Airport (TYS) and Downtown Island Airport (DKX) under the direction of the Metropolitan Knoxville Airport Authority. Responsibilities included serving as Director of the 2016 Smoky Mountain Air Show, and filling the role of Vice President of Operations which included being the Accountable Executive for FAA Safety Management and TN OSHA Compliance for both airports (with more than 90 staff members being accountable to him). During this time he was assigned as Chief Operating Officer-Consolidated Airport Services, LLC., (responsible for the formation and implementation of a business plan to provide outsourced ground handling and other associated services for multiple airline operations). He continued with MKAA as Director of Airport Operations, Airport Operations Manager, Engineering Project Manager, and as Environmental Compliance Manager.
